Understanding Marijuana and Its Effects

Marijuana, a widely used psychoactive substance, is derived from the cannabis plant and has been utilized for various purposes throughout history, including medicinal, recreational, and spiritual practices. Understanding the types and components of marijuana is crucial for discerning its effects and potential therapeutic benefits. In this section, we will explore the diverse array of marijuana strains and the primary chemical constituents that contribute to their unique characteristics and effects.

Types of Marijuana:

Sativa: Sativa strains are known for their energizing and uplifting effects. They are typically consumed during the day to enhance creativity, focus, and productivity. Sativa plants are tall and have narrow leaves.

Indica: Indica strains are more relaxing and sedating. They are often used in the evening or at night to promote sleep and relaxation. Indica plants are shorter and bushier compared to sativa plants.

Hybrids: Hybrid strains are a mix of both sativa and indica genetics. They can provide a balance of both uplifting and relaxing effects, depending on the specific strain.

Components of Marijuana:

Cannabinoids: Cannabinoids are the chemical compounds found in marijuana that interact with the body’s endocannabinoid system. The two most well-known cannabinoids are:

Tetrahydrocannabinol (THC): THC is the primary psychoactive compound in marijuana, responsible for the “high” or euphoric feeling. It also has various therapeutic effects, including pain relief, appetite stimulation, and nausea reduction.

Cannabidiol (CBD): CBD is non-psychoactive and has gained attention for its potential therapeutic benefits, such as reducing anxiety, inflammation, and seizures. It can also counteract some of the negative effects of THC, such as anxiety and paranoia.

Terpenes: Terpenes are aromatic compounds found in marijuana that give each strain its unique flavor and aroma profile. They also contribute to the overall effects of the strain. For example:

Myrcene: Found in many cannabis strains, myrcene is known for its sedative effects and is often associated with indica strains.

Limonene: This citrus-scented terpene is believed to have mood-enhancing and anti-anxiety properties.

Pinene: As the name suggests, pinene has a pine aroma and is associated with increased alertness and memory retention.

Flavonoids: Flavonoids are another group of phytonutrients found in marijuana that have antioxidant and anti-inflammatory properties. They contribute to the plant’s color and may also have therapeutic effects.

The Endocannabinoid System: A Key Player in Marijuana’s Impact

The endocannabinoid system (ECS) serves as a crucial regulator within the human body, orchestrating a wide array of physiological processes to maintain balance and homeostasis. Comprising cannabinoid receptors, endocannabinoids, and enzymes, the ECS plays a pivotal role in modulating neurotransmitter release, synaptic plasticity, and immune function. When marijuana compounds interact with the ECS, particularly tetrahydrocannabinol (THC), they mimic the actions of endogenous cannabinoids, influencing mood, appetite, pain perception, and other bodily functions. By engaging with cannabinoid receptors, THC can induce a cascade of effects, leading to alterations in perception, cognition, and behavior. Conversely, cannabidiol (CBD) interacts with the ECS in a more nuanced manner, exerting modulatory effects on receptor activity and neurotransmitter signaling without producing intoxication. Understanding the intricate interplay between marijuana compounds and the ECS is essential for comprehending the plant’s impact on physiological processes and its potential therapeutic applications.

The Role of THC: Sedative Effects and the Sleep-Wake Cycle

Tetrahydrocannabinol (THC), the primary psychoactive compound in marijuana, is often associated with sedative effects. THC interacts with cannabinoid receptors in the brain, particularly in regions involved in the regulation of sleep and wakefulness. Research indicates that THC can shorten the time it takes to fall asleep and increase total sleep time. However, it may also disrupt the sleep cycle, reducing the amount of time spent in rapid eye movement (REM) sleep, which is crucial for cognitive function and overall well-being. Consequently, while THC may promote sleep in the short term, chronic use or high doses could potentially lead to sleep disturbances and daytime fatigue.

CBD: Balancing Act or Sleep Aid?

Cannabidiol (CBD), another prominent cannabinoid found in marijuana, has garnered attention for its potential role in promoting relaxation and reducing anxiety without the intoxicating effects of THC. While CBD may not directly induce drowsiness like THC, some research suggests that it could indirectly impact sleep by alleviating factors that contribute to insomnia, such as stress and anxiety. Additionally, CBD has been investigated for its potential to regulate the sleep-wake cycle and improve sleep quality, although more research is needed to fully understand its mechanisms of action and efficacy in this regard. Overall, CBD’s effects on sleep are complex and may vary depending on individual factors such as dosage and underlying sleep disorders.

The Importance of Terpenes: Aromatic Compounds and Their Influence on Energy Levels

Terpenes are aromatic compounds found in marijuana and many other plants, contributing to their distinctive scents and flavors. Beyond sensory qualities, terpenes also play a significant role in modulating the effects of marijuana, including its impact on energy levels. For example, terpenes such as limonene and pinene are associated with uplifting and energizing effects, potentially counteracting feelings of lethargy or sedation induced by cannabinoids like THC. Conversely, terpenes such as myrcene may contribute to the sedative effects of indica strains. Understanding the influence of terpenes on the effects of marijuana strains can provide valuable insights into their potential impact on energy levels and overall experience.

Individual Variations: Why Weed Affects Everyone Differently

Tolerance and Sensitivity: Factors at Play

Tolerance refers to the body’s adaptation to the effects of marijuana over time, resulting in diminished response to the same dose. Individuals with high tolerance may require higher doses to achieve desired effects, while those with low tolerance may experience stronger effects from smaller doses. Conversely, sensitivity refers to individual susceptibility to the effects of marijuana, with some individuals experiencing pronounced effects even at low doses, while others may require higher doses to feel any effect at all. Factors influencing tolerance and sensitivity include frequency and duration of use, genetic predispositions, and individual differences in metabolism and neurochemistry.

External Factors: Environment and Lifestyle Choices

External factors such as environment and lifestyle choices can also influence how marijuana affects individuals. Environmental factors include setting (e.g., social context, physical surroundings) and mode of consumption (e.g., smoking, vaping, edibles), which can impact the onset, intensity, and duration of effects. Lifestyle choices such as diet, exercise, sleep patterns, and concurrent substance use can also interact with marijuana use, influencing its effects on energy levels, mood, and overall well-being. Additionally, mental state and emotional state at the time of marijuana use can shape the subjective experience, with factors such as stress, anxiety, and mood playing a significant role in how marijuana affects individuals. Overall, recognizing the interplay between internal factors (genetics, tolerance, sensitivity) and external factors (environment, lifestyle choices) is essential for understanding why marijuana affects everyone differently and tailoring its use to individual needs and preferences.
